My idea for my landscape painting was to paint something that means something to me. I painted a city skyline, I took inspiration from a trip I took with my siblings to Chicago. I wanted to paint a city for my landscape because cities are my favorite places to be and Chicago brings me happiness whenever I visit. To paint this I first started by painting the background a dark grayish blue color and then traced a photo onto the canvas. The first part I painted were the trees and lake because I thought they would be easiest. To paint the bushes and trees I used a dark green at first and went over to add details with a light green. I painted the skyscrapers a grey color with yellow and white to portray the windows. For the lake I used blue and black acrylic paint to show that it was a lake but a night time. For a lot of the parts I had to use two different colors to achieve detail and the right color. When painting this my intention was to show the beauty and good parts of a city. When people look at the painting I want people to see how freeing being in a big city can be and make you feel. The hardest part when painting this painting was adding the detail into the skyscrapers and painting the railing of the lake because they are such small things to paint. Everytime I mess up on painting one of those parts I just restarted and changed the brush or amount of paint I was using and accepted how it would look.
